Program Technician I
Admin - Laboratory
and Research
Summary of Job Duties
The
Program Technician will work in the serology and microbiology labs within the
Veterinary Diagnostic Lab (VDL). Serology work includes the preparation of
blood samples and reagents for evaluation of serum samples utilizing
Enzyme-Linked ImmunoSorbent Assay (ELISA), Agar Gel Immunodiffusion (AGID),
Hemagglutination-Inhibition (HI) and Serum Plate Agglutination (SPA)
methodologies. Microbiology work includes isolation and identification of
aerobic, anaerobic, and fungal organisms; NPIP Salmonella assays;
antimicrobial sensitivity testing; and molecular rtPCR assays for
identification of microorganisms.

Senior Research Assistant
Admin -
Laboratory and Research
Position Description
This
position requires developing micro vascular technique such as composite
tissue transplantation, skin and solid organ transplant procedures. Conducts
immunologic assays and procedures requiring familiarity with sterile tissue
culture techniques. Performs cellular immunology procedures to include the
isolation of tissues (spleen, lymph node, bone marrow), preparation of bone
marrow chimeras, tissue immunohistochemistry, and flow cytometric analysis of
research samples. Requires familiarity with basic laboratory techniques, such
as preparing cell growth media, sorting media and preparation of samples for
flow cytometry. Processes bone marrow and/or islets for use in clinical
transplantation under FDA approved clinical trials.
